I was thinking of downloading some sort of web accelerator for my home dial-up (preferably a free one) and I was wondering if anyone here uses one. Several ISPs offer them like AOL, Net Zero, EV1, etc. (mine doesn’t). Anyways I was wondering what you guys thought of the service particularly if you got one from a second party like Propel or Web Jet. I understand it doesn’t help with music files or other things like that, but it can compress jpegs etc. making dial-ups a little more tolerable. thanks.
I had Web Jet for EV1, and the only thing it really did was make pages with images on them load faster by making the images blurry. Other than that it doesn't do much.
